This patch adds a small setup script to set up huge memory
pages during the kvm tests execution. Also, added hugepage setup to the
fc8_quick sample.

diff --git a/client/tests/kvm/scripts/hugepage.py
b/client/tests/kvm/scripts/hugepage.py
new file mode 100644
index 0000000..dc36da4
--- /dev/null
+++ b/client/tests/kvm/scripts/hugepage.py
@@ -0,0 +1,109 @@
+#!/usr/bin/python
+# -*- coding: utf-8 -*-
+import os, sys, time
+
+"""
+Simple script to allocate enough hugepages for KVM testing purposes.
+"""
+
+class HugePageError(Exception):
+ """
+ Simple wrapper for the builtin Exception class.
+ """
+ pass
+
+
+class HugePage:
+ def __init__(self, hugepage_path=None):
+ """
+ Gets environment variable values and calculates the target number
+ of huge memory pages.
+
+ @param hugepage_path: Path where to mount hugetlbfs path, if not
+ yet configured.
+ """
+ self.vms = len(os.environ['KVM_TEST_vms'].split())
+ self.mem = int(os.environ['KVM_TEST_mem'])
+ try:
+ self.max_vms = int(os.environ['KVM_TEST_max_vms'])
+ except KeyError:
+ self.max_vms = 0
+
+ if hugepage_path:
+ self.hugepage_path = hugepage_path
+ else:
+ self.hugepage_path = '/mnt/kvm_hugepage'
+
+ self.hugepage_size = self.get_hugepage_size()
+ self.target_hugepages = self.get_target_hugepages()
+
+
+ def get_hugepage_size(self):
+ """
+ Get the current system setting for huge memory page size.
+ """
+ meminfo = open('/proc/meminfo', 'r').readlines()
+ huge_line_list = [h for h in meminfo if h.startswith("Hugepagesize")]
+ try:
+ return int(huge_line_list[0].split()[1])
+ except ValueError, e:
+ raise HugePageError("Could not get huge page size setting from "
+ "/proc/meminfo: %s" % e)
+
+
+ def get_target_hugepages(self):
+ """
+ Calculate the target number of hugepages for testing purposes.
+ """
+ if self.vms< self.max_vms:
+ self.vms = self.max_vms
+ vmsm = (self.vms * self.mem) + (self.vms * 64)
+ return int(vmsm * 1024 / self.hugepage_size)
+
+
+ def set_hugepages(self):
+ """
+ Sets the hugepage limit to the target hugepage value calculated.
+ """
+ hugepage_cfg = open("/proc/sys/vm/nr_hugepages", "r+")
+ hp = hugepage_cfg.readline()
+ while int(hp)< self.target_hugepages:
+ loop_hp = hp
+ hugepage_cfg.write(str(self.target_hugepages))
+ hugepage_cfg.flush()
+ hugepage_cfg.seek(0)
+ hp = int(hugepage_cfg.readline())
+ if loop_hp == hp:
+ raise HugePageError("Cannot set the kernel hugepage setting "
+ "to the target value of %d hugepages." %
+ self.target_hugepages)
+ hugepage_cfg.close()
+
+
+ def mount_hugepage_fs(self):
+ """
+ Verify if there's a hugetlbfs mount set. If there's none, will set up
+ a hugetlbfs mount using the class attribute that defines the mount
+ point.
+ """
+ if not os.path.ismount(self.hugepage_path):
+ if not os.path.isdir(self.hugepage_path):
+ os.makedirs(self.hugepage_path)
+ cmd = "mount -t hugetlbfs none %s" % self.hugepage_path
+ if os.system(cmd):
+ raise HugePageError("Cannot mount hugetlbfs path %s" %
+ self.hugepage_path)
+
+
+ def setup(self):
+ self.set_hugepages()
+ self.mount_hugepage_fs()
+
+
+if __name__ == "__main__":
+ if len(sys.argv)< 2:
+ huge_page = HugePage()
+ else:
+ huge_page = HugePage(sys.argv[1])
+
+ huge_page.setup()
